Abstrait
  • This project seeks to identify factors that contribute to a female adolescent's inability to appropriately express anger and to identify what may be helpful in dealing with this inability through pastoral counseling. After discussing anger, especially the affect theory of Silvan S. Tomkins, it presents traditional undertandings of adolescent development and identifies new findings regarding female development, beginning with the work of Carol Gilligan. A case study provides a view of specific clinical work with a female adolescent struggling to speak her anger. The pastoral counseling relationship becomes a safe place for mutual exploration of issues involved in integrating anger as a life-giving affect.
